Almond Acres Academy celebrates ribbon cutting at new campus

– More than 100 Paso Roblans participated in an open house and ribbon cutting to kick off the new academic year at Almond Acres Academy on Niblick Road in Paso Robles. On Monday, Aug. 15, parents and students will find out who their teachers will be this year. The charter school will open Wednesday, Aug. 17 at the new campus, which will give students a full academic year at the new campus.

Almond Acres Academy families celebrate groundbreaking in Paso Robles

School makes significant steps toward new facility as construction process gets underway –Almond Acres Academy, a tuition-free, public charter school successfully serving students and families in the area since 2012, is celebrating its new school building becoming a reality for students to enjoy beginning in the fall of 2021. A recent groundbreaking began the construction of a new campus on Niblick Road just west of Creston Road in Paso Robles at the site of a former church. “The road back here has been a bit long, but we finally have our new home in sight,” said Robert Bourgault, executive director. “The Paso Robles community has welcomed us back, and we are so very grateful to build a permanent home here for our families. With our new building, we’ll be able to serve more students in their quests to become the very best versions of themselves.”
